Sendo, the British mobile phone manufacturer, and Opera Software today announced that Opera technology underpins the Sendo X's Internet browser. With Opera's technology, the Sendo X delivers meaningful mobile Internet content, any time, any place, in a small and light device.
Opera's innovative "Small-Screen Rendering" ™ (SSR) reformats the Web to Sendo X's screen size. No horizontal scrolling is needed for a great Internet experience.

Sendo, headquartered in the United Kingdom, started shipping its first terminals to operator customers in Europe and Asia in June 2001. The company is now shipping products in over forty territories in Europe, the Middle East, Asia, Africa and the Americas. Opera Software ASA has redefined Web browsing for PCs, mobile phones and other networked devices. Opera's cross-platform Web browser technology is renowned for its performance, standards compliance and small size, while giving users a faster, safer and more dynamic online experience. Opera Software is headquartered in Oslo, Norway, with offices around the world. The company is listed on the Oslo Stock Exchange under the ticker symbol OPERA.
